The clever way I could see it done is if somebody created a converter script which took the Thief 2 .mis files and converted them to TDM .map files, either substituting best-fit textures and objects, or I guess the script could just outright import T2's textures and objects and other things (and convert anything it needs to), so T2 zip files go in and TDM .pk4 files come out, if we're pipedreaing this anyway. Then they could just release that script which people who own Thief 2 could run, pointing it to their T2 map folder, and get the TDM maps spit out. I think that'd be legal. Not only could we get Thief 1 and 2 maps out, but we could also get FM maps spit out as well, which would I think quintuple the number of FMs we have in one shot. Actually this is kind of an awesome idea, now that I think about it.

 

The thing is that Thief maps use negative geometry (cutting holes out) and TDM uses positive geometry (placing solid blocks). So it wouldn't be a simple conversion at all, and I'd think you'd have to cover a lot of exceptional situations that don't fit an easy mold that you might have to just hack in. But, like many things, we have the source for both games, so it's possible in principle. The question is just how much work someone is ready to put in to study up & do it.
